#dc0b9c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dc0b9c is composed of 86.3% red, 4.3%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95% magenta, 29.1%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 318.4 degrees, a saturation of 90.5% and a lightness of 45.3%. #dc0b9c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ff16ff with #b90039.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

#dc0b9c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dc0b9c has RGB values of R:220, G:11,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.95, Y:0.29,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14420892.

Shades and Tints of #dc0b9c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f010a is the darkest color, while #fffb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#dc0b9c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a6d76 is the less saturated color, while #e5029f is the most saturated one.
